A conducting square frame with a side a 10 cm is placed on a horizontal desk. A de current of 2 A (supplied by some external source) flows around the frame in the counterclockwise direction. A constant and spatially uniform external magnetic field B = 0.25 T is applied in the upward vertical direction. (a) Calculate and draw the forces acting on each of the edges of the frame. Be sure to clearly indicate the directions of these forces. (b) What is the torque acting on the frame? If the direction of the magnetic field (but not the magnitude) can vary, for what direction(s) will the torque be maximized?
